What is High Blood Pressure?

Hypertension, or high blood pressure, occurs when the force of blood against the artery walls stays consistently high. A normal reading is around 120/80 mmHg, while 140/90 mmHg or above is considered high and may require medical attention. This condition poses additional stress on the heart and blood vessels, which increases the risk of serious health problems such as heart disease, stroke, and kidney damage. Since hypertension often develops gradually and cannot show obvious symptoms, regular health check-up is important for regular health check-up and effective management.

Symptoms of High Blood Pressure

Hypertension is often called a “silent killer” because it may not cause noticeable symptoms in its early stages. Many individuals may have high blood pressure for years without realizing it, as it often develops slowly and shows no noticeable symptoms in the beginning. However, when the situation becomes severe or reaches dangerous levels, some signs and symptoms may appear. These symptoms vary from person to another and may be wrong for other health issues. This is why regular monitoring is necessary, especially for those who have obesity, stress or high blood pressure as risk factors.

 

Common symptoms of high blood pressure may include:

 

Frequent headache – usually dull or throbbing in nature.

 

Feeling dizzy or light-headed, beaded or unstable.

 

Blurred or double vision – due to an increase in pressure affecting the eyes.

 

Chest pain or tightness, especially during hard work.

 

Shortness of breath, especially after physical activity.

 

Fatigue or fatigue – a constant feeling of low energy.

 

Nosebleeds – May occur in cases of excessively high blood pressure, especially when BP suddenly spikes.

 

Irregular heartbeat – a feeling of an abnormal or intensifying heartbeat.

Causes of High Blood Pressure

Hypertension can develop due to a combination of lifestyle factors, medical conditions, or genetic causes. It is usually classified into two types: Primary (essential) hypertension, which develops gradually with age and has no specific cause, and Secondary hypertension, which results from an underlying health condition such as kidney disease or hormonal disorders.

 

Common causes of high blood pressure include:

 

Unhealthy diet – excess salt, processed food, and low intake of fruits and vegetables can increase blood pressure.

 

Obesity – Extra body weight puts added strain on the heart and blood vessels, raising blood pressure levels.

 

Lack of physical activity – An inactive lifestyle lowers heart strength and often leads to weight gain, both of which increase the risk of hypertension.

 

Smoking and alcohol – These damage blood vessels and increase blood pressure levels.

 

Stress – Continuous mental stress triggers hormone release that tightens blood vessels.

 

Genetic factors – The risk of high blood pressure is increased by a family history.

 

Chronic conditions – kidney disease, thyroid disorder, and diabetes can lead to high blood pressure.

 

Aging – Blood vessels naturally become rigid with age, which increases the pressure.

 

Some medicines – Birth control pills, pain relievers, or decongestants may increase blood pressure.

How to Diagnose High Blood Pressure?

Hypertension is usually diagnosed using a sphygmomanometer, a device that measures blood pressure in millimeters of mercury (MMHG). The readings include two values – systolic (upper value) and diastolic (lower value).

 

Urine testing – to detect kidney problems or proteins in urine

 

Blood test – to check cholesterol levels, blood sugar, or kidney function

 

ECG (Electrocardiogram) – To detect any irregular heart rhythm or stress on the heart

 

Echocardiogram – A detailed ultrasound test used to examine the structure of the heart and evaluate how well it is functioning.

Prevention of High Blood Pressure

Making small changes in your routine can help to keep your blood pressure naturally under control:

 

Exercise regularly: at least 30 minutes of moderate activity daily

 

Eat a balanced diet: Include fruits, vegetables, and whole grains

 

Reduce salt intake: Avoid salty snacks and processed foods

 

Limit caffeine and alcohol: These can increase blood pressure

 

Manage stress: Practice meditation, deep breathing, or yoga

 

Get enough sleep: target for 7-8 hours of quality sleep

 

Quit smoking: It damages your blood vessels and increases your BP
